If you’re looking for a vessel that refuses to compromise between shallow-water stealth and offshore capability, the 2015 Action Craft 2170 is the gold standard. Known for its “Hybrid” design, this boat is just as comfortable stalking redfish in 10 inches of water as it is crossing choppy bays to reach the reef.
Key Specifications & Performance
The 2170 CC is built on Action Craft’s patented Qui-Dry® hull and Pocket Drive® technology. This unique combination ensures a bone-dry ride in a chop while allowing the boat to jump on plane in incredibly shallow depths.
Length: 21′ 2″Beam: 8′ 4″
Draft: Approx. 10″–12″ (load dependent)
Fuel Capacity: 75 Gallons
Hull Design: Signature modified-V with high-performance steps.
Features for the Serious Angler. This isn’t just a boat; it’s a fishing platform designed by people who actually spend time on the water.
Massive Fishing Decks: Extra-wide gunwales and huge casting decks (bow and stern) provide 360-degree fishability.
Livewell System: Equipped with dual livewells (typically a 32-gallon rear and a 22-gallon forward) featuring high-speed pickups.
Storage Galore: Lockable rod storage that fits full-sized fly rods and deep dry-storage compartments for all your gear.
The “Pocket Drive”: This hull feature allows the engine to be mounted higher, reducing the draft and protecting the prop in the “skinny” water.
Comfort & Build Quality
While it’s a fishing machine first, the 2015 2170 CC doesn’t skimp on the details that make a day on the water enjoyable.
Seating: Features a comfortable leaning post and integrated rear bench seating that folds down to extend the aft casting deck.
Unsinkable Construction: Action Craft uses premium resins and foam injection, creating a rigid, quiet, and incredibly safe hull.
Self-Bailing Cockpit: Designed to shed water quickly, whether from a washdown or an unexpected swell.
By 2015, Action Craft had perfected the 2170’s layout, offering modern console designs that easily accommodate large-screen GPS/Fishfinder units and updated upholstery that stands the test of time.
